Multipole polarizabilities of helium and the hydrogen negative ion with Coulomb and screened Coulomb potentials

We have carried out calculations of multipole polarizabilities of helium and the hydrogen negative ion interacting with pure Coulomb and screened Coulomb potentials using highly accurate correlated exponential wave functions with exponent generated by a quasirandom process. The dipole, quadrupole, and octupole polarizabilities for the ground 1s{sup 2} {sup 1}S{sup e} state for different screening parameters starting from infinity (pure Coulomb case) to small values of the screening parameters, are reported. The octupole polarizability of the hydrogen negative ion is reported for the first time in the literature. The bound 4 {sup 1}F state energy of helium for different screening parameters are also reported.
